There are three approaches to finding probability that you will discuss in this unit; theoretical probability, relative frequency probability, and subjective probability.

1.     From your own experience either personally or professionally, provide an example of when you have encountered or used theoretical probability. Describe the example and explain why it is theoretical probability.

2.     From your own experience either personally or professionally, provide an example of when you have encountered or used relative frequency probability. Describe the example and explain why it is relative frequency probability.

3.     From your own experience either personally or professionally, provide an example of when you have encountered or used subjective probability. Describe the example and explain why it is subjective probability.

Solution

1. Theoretical probability was used by me when I was computing my chances of winning in a die game, where two dice were being rolled and I had to place bets on whether the sum of the numbers on them will be greater than, equal to or less than 7.

This was theoretical probability because, assuming that the dice was fair, I was computing the ratio of the number of ways in which the event desired could occur, divided by the total number of outcomes.

2. I use relative frequency probability to guess whether my favourite football team will win a match or not.

This is relative frequency probability because I consider the ratio of the number of past wins(desired outcome) of my team and the total number of matches played between the two teams(total count) to calculate the desired probability.

3. I often use subjective probability to calculate the chances of me being able to catch the bus to college.

This is subjective as I make a personal estimate based on my experience in the matter about when the bus will come, and do not mathematically calculate the probability of the bus coming.
